2. 1. Pendahuluan
Sebelum memahami konsep jaringan dan implemantasi jaringan komputer pada sebuah sistem, terlebih
dahulu memerlukan tool yang biasa digunakan untuk melakukan setting jaringan, mengoptimasi
jaringan dan membuat pekerjaan yang sebelumnya dilakukan secara manual dapat dikerjakan secara
otomatis menggunakan perintah optimasi.
Tool jaringan
• Ping
tool ini digunakan untuk memerikas sambungan/koneksi dari suatu peralatan jaringan yang berbasis
TCP/IP. Perintah ini digunakan untuk memastikan apakah sambungan tidak ada masalah dengan
melihat informasi yang dihasilkan dari tool ini berupa waktu pengembalian data yang dikirim
ilustrasi ping terlihat dibawah ini
• netstat
netstat ( network statistics) adalah tool yang digunakan untuk menampilkan informasi koneksi yang
masuk maupun informasi yang keluar. Tool ini juga digunakan untuk menampilkan table routing dan
statistik dari interface.
3. • Mtr
Perintah ini merupakan gabungan dari perintah ping dan traceroute yang digunakan untuk melakukan
diagnosa pada jaringan tcp/ip. Contoh berikut dilakukan dengan menggunakan perintah mtr
www.eepis-its.edu
• iptraf
Iptraff adalah tool jaringan berbasis konsol yang ada dilinux. Tool ini berfungsi untuk
mengumpulkan informasi seperti koneksi TCP berupa paket, jumlah byte yang diterima,
statistik interface dan indikator aktivitas jaringan dan sebagainya.
4. • Route
Tool ini digunakan untuk memanipulasi table routing dan juga menampilkan status routing
termasuk informasi gateway.
• Nslookup
tool yang digunakan untuk query dengan internet. Tool umum digunakan untuk mengetahui
detail sebuah domain dari situs. Contoh penggunaannya sebagai berikut
hendri@hendri-desktop:~$ nslookup www.yahoo.com
Server: 202.154.178.2
Address: 202.154.178.2#53
Non-authoritative answer:
www.yahoo.com canonical name = fp.wg1.b.yahoo.com.
fp.wg1.b.yahoo.com canonical name = any-fp.wa1.b.yahoo.com.
Name: any-fp.wa1.b.yahoo.com
5. Address: 69.147.125.65
Name: any-fp.wa1.b.yahoo.com
Address: 67.195.160.76
• Dig
tool ini hampir sama penggunaannya dengan nslookup yang digunakan untuk melihat informasi yang
berkenaan dengan suatu domain.
hendri@hendri-desktop:~$ dig yahoo.com
; <<>> DiG 9.7.1-P2 <<>> yahoo.com
;; global options: +cmd
;; Got answer:
;; ->>HEADER<<- opcode: QUERY, status: NOERROR, id: 63497
;; flags: qr rd ra; QUERY: 1, ANSWER: 5, AUTHORITY: 7, ADDITIONAL: 7
;; QUESTION SECTION:
;yahoo.com. IN A
;; ANSWER SECTION:
yahoo.com. 13844 IN A 209.191.122.70
yahoo.com. 13844 IN A 67.195.160.76
yahoo.com. 13844 IN A 69.147.125.65
yahoo.com. 13844 IN A 72.30.2.43
yahoo.com. 13844 IN A 98.137.149.56
;; AUTHORITY SECTION:
yahoo.com. 44126 IN NS ns5.yahoo.com.
yahoo.com. 44126 IN NS ns6.yahoo.com.
yahoo.com. 44126 IN NS ns8.yahoo.com.
yahoo.com. 44126 IN NS ns1.yahoo.com.
yahoo.com. 44126 IN NS ns2.yahoo.com.
yahoo.com. 44126 IN NS ns3.yahoo.com.
yahoo.com. 44126 IN NS ns4.yahoo.com.
;; ADDITIONAL SECTION:
ns1.yahoo.com. 130357 IN A 68.180.131.16
ns2.yahoo.com. 84874 IN A 68.142.255.16
ns3.yahoo.com. 92356 IN A 121.101.152.99
ns4.yahoo.com. 12829 IN A 68.142.196.63
ns5.yahoo.com. 92356 IN A 119.160.247.124
ns6.yahoo.com. 154354 IN A 202.43.223.170
ns8.yahoo.com. 154354 IN A 202.165.104.22
;; Query time: 3 msec
;; SERVER: 202.154.178.2#53(202.154.178.2)
;; WHEN: Thu Oct 14 12:55:18 2010
;; MSG SIZE rcvd: 345
hendri@hendri-desktop:~$
• Host
perintah ini digunakan untuk mengetahui keanggotaan dari sebuah domain
hendri@hendri-desktop:~$ host -vl eepis-its.edu
6. Trying "elka.eepis-its.edu"
; Transfer failed.
Trying "elka.eepis-its.edu.eepis-its.edu"
Host elka.eepis-its.edu.eepis-its.edu not found: 9(NOTAUTH)
Received 50 bytes from 202.154.178.2#53 in 18 ms
; Transfer failed.
hendri@hendri-desktop:~$ host -vl eepis-its.edu
Trying "eepis-its.edu"
;; ->>HEADER<<- opcode: QUERY, status: NOERROR, id: 18518
;; flags: qr aa ra; QUERY: 1, ANSWER: 590, AUTHORITY: 0, ADDITIONAL: 0
;; QUESTION SECTION:
;
;; ANSWER SECTION:
eepis-its.edu. 86400 IN NS ns1.eepis-its.edu.
eepis-its.edu. 86400 IN NS ns2.eepis-its.edu.
eepis-its.edu. 86400 IN A 202.154.178.14
102-b769dfbf3ee.eepis-its.edu. 1800 IN A 10.252.240.171
642C413E.eepis-its.edu. 1800 IN A 10.208.8.1
6477F783.eepis-its.edu. 1800 IN A 202.154.178.1
abc.eepis-its.edu. 1800 IN A 10.252.2.207
abel.eepis-its.edu. 1800 IN A 10.252.102.57
acer.eepis-its.edu. 1800 IN A 10.252.110.250
acer-bf494133fd.eepis-its.edu. 1800 IN A 10.252.8.237
ai5-desktop.eepis-its.edu. 1800 IN A 10.252.61.228
alumni.eepis-its.edu. 86400 IN A 202.154.178.14
amm-b4c227222e5.eepis-its.edu. 1800 IN A 10.252.11.52
anangbk-aff2580.eepis-its.edu. 1800 IN A 10.252.11.242
andikurnia-pc.eepis-its.edu. 1800 IN A 10.252.11.121
andri-1669f16e1.eepis-its.edu. 1800 IN A 10.252.12.206
arie.eepis-its.edu. 1800 IN A 202.154.178.1
ArIeS.eepis-its.edu. 1800 IN A 10.252.11.156
Arman-PC.eepis-its.edu. 1800 IN A 10.252.43.217
asa.eepis-its.edu. 86400 IN A 202.154.178.127
asa-inherent.eepis-its.edu. 86400 IN A 167.205.138.182
axioo.eepis-its.edu. 1800 IN A 10.252.10.215
b2.eepis-its.edu. 86400 IN A 202.154.178.52
b7000.eepis-its.edu. 86400 IN A 202.154.178.12
b7000i.eepis-its.edu. 1800 IN A 202.154.178.1
backbone.eepis-its.edu. 86400 IN A 202.154.178.13
backup.eepis-its.edu. 86400 IN A 202.154.178.26
ban.eepis-its.edu. 86400 IN A 202.154.178.5
bem.eepis-its.edu. 86400 IN A 202.154.178.3
berlian-icore.eepis-its.edu. 1800 IN A 10.252.2.216
blog.eepis-its.edu. 86400 IN A 202.154.178.5
*.blog.eepis-its.edu. 86400 IN A 202.154.178.5
box.eepis-its.edu. 21600 IN A 10.252.108.111
cad00.eepis-its.edu. 1800 IN A 10.252.106.85
cad06.eepis-its.edu. 1800 IN A 10.252.106.109
cad11.eepis-its.edu. 1800 IN A 10.252.106.102
cad15.eepis-its.edu. 1800 IN A 10.252.106.95
cad16.eepis-its.edu. 1800 IN A 10.252.106.65
cad18.eepis-its.edu. 1800 IN A 10.252.106.231
cad27.eepis-its.edu. 1800 IN A 10.252.106.171
7. cafe-elista.eepis-its.edu. 1800 IN A 10.252.240.216
cc.eepis-its.edu. 86400 IN A 202.154.178.11
cctv.eepis-its.edu. 86400 IN A 202.154.178.14
ce007.eepis-its.edu. 1800 IN A 10.252.36.82
CEEEPIS.eepis-its.edu. 1800 IN A 10.252.36.223
cgv12-desktop.eepis-its.edu. 1800 IN A 10.252.61.231
citeseerx.eepis-its.edu. 86400 IN A 202.154.178.14
cnap.eepis-its.edu. 86400 IN A 202.154.178.14
collage-92a693f.eepis-its.edu. 1800 IN A 10.252.240.95
COMPAQ-PC.eepis-its.edu. 1800 IN A 10.252.11.87
core.eepis-its.edu. 86400 IN A 202.154.178.1
cvg11-desktop.eepis-its.edu. 1800 IN A 10.252.61.225
cvg14-desktop.eepis-its.edu. 1800 IN A 10.252.61.237
cvg15-desktop.eepis-its.edu. 1800 IN A 10.252.61.241
cvg16-desktop.eepis-its.edu. 1800 IN A 10.252.61.226
cvg18-desktop.eepis-its.edu. 1800 IN A 10.252.61.230
cvg2-desktop.eepis-its.edu. 1800 IN A 10.252.61.240
cvg20-desktop.eepis-its.edu. 1800 IN A 10.252.61.242
cvg22-desktop.eepis-its.edu. 1800 IN A 10.252.61.247
cvg25-desktop.eepis-its.edu. 1800 IN A 10.252.36.88
cvg3-desktop.eepis-its.edu. 1800 IN A 10.252.61.235
Received 20728 bytes from 202.154.178.2#53 in 53 ms
• Tcpdump
tcpdump adalah program yang digunakan untuk menangkap paket-paket informasi yang berada pada
jaringan.
root@hendri-desktop:/home/hendri# /usr/sbin/tcpdump -pln -i wlan0 | grep
10.252.102.1
tcpdump: verbose output suppressed, use -v or -vv for full protocol decode
listening on wlan0, link-type EN10MB (Ethernet), capture size 65535 bytes
13:45:29.912382 IP 10.252.102.171.137 > 10.252.102.255.137: NBT UDP
PACKET(137): QUERY; REQUEST; BROADCAST
13:45:30.210359 IP 10.252.102.171.137 > 10.252.102.255.137: NBT UDP
PACKET(137): QUERY; REQUEST; BROADCAST
13:45:30.662713 IP 10.252.102.171.137 > 10.252.102.255.137: NBT UDP
PACKET(137): QUERY; REQUEST; BROADCAST
8. • Nmap
Nmap (Network Mapper) adalah utilities jaringan yang biasa digunakan untuk explorasi dan
auditing security. Banyak sistem dan administrators jaringan untuk tugas audit jaringan, memonitor
port dan uptime.
• Ifconfig
perintah ini digunakan untuk mengatur konfigurasi ip pada interface yang terhubung dengan jaringan /
card network. Contoh ifconfig -a menampilkan setting ip pada interface yang ada dikomputer
root@hendri-desktop:/home/hendri# ifconfig -a
eth0 Link encap:Ethernet HWaddr 00:24:81:ce:39:a7
UP BROADCAST MULTICAST MTU:1500 Metric:1
RX packets:0 errors:0 dropped:0 overruns:0 frame:0
T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
RX bytes:0 (0.0 B) TX bytes:0 (0.0 B)
Interrupt:44 Base address:0xc000
lo Link encap:Local Loopback
inet addr:127.0.0.1 Mask:255.0.0.0
inet6 addr: ::1/128 Scope:Host
UP LOOPBACK RUNNING MTU:16436 Metric:1
RX packets:271773 errors:0 dropped:0 overruns:0 frame:0
9. TX packets:271773 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:0
RX bytes:211219261 (211.2 MB) TX bytes:211219261 (211.2 MB)
vboxnet0 Link encap:Ethernet HWaddr 0a:00:27:00:00:00
BROADCAST MULTICAST MTU:1500 Metric:1
RX packets:0 errors:0 dropped:0 overruns:0 frame:0
T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
RX bytes:0 (0.0 B) TX bytes:0 (0.0 B)
wlan0 Link encap:Ethernet HWaddr 00:22:5f:fa:f6:0c
inet addr:10.252.102.103 Bcast:10.252.102.255
Mask:255.255.255.0
inet6 addr: fe80::222:5fff:fefa:f60c/64 Scope:Link
U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1
RX packets:207667 errors:0 dropped:0 overruns:0 frame:0
TX packets:120885 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
RX bytes:210802814 (210.8 MB) TX bytes:19254998 (19.2 MB)
ifconfig wlan0 down → mematikan interfacing wlan0
ifconfig wlan0 up → menghidupkan interface wlan0
2. Langkah percobaan
• Jalankan perintah ping, netstat, mtr, route, nslookup, dig, host, iptraf, tcpdump,nmap pada situs
lecturer.eepis-its.edu, fileserver.eepis-its.edu dan www.google.com catat informasi apa yang
diperoleh,
• tambahkan perintah man sebelum perintah diatas, kemudian tambahkan beberapa opsi, catat apa
yang terjadi
3. Tugas
• Bagaimana caranya untuk mengetahui berapa jumlah komputer yang terhubung dan online
dalam jaringan anda? Bagaimana perintahnya. Laporkan hasilnya
• apakah pens.its.ac.id dan eepis-its.edu terhubung ke server yang sama? Bagaimana cara
memastikannya
• layanan apa yang dapat anda lihat pada www.eepis-its.edu?
• Buat kesimpulan dari percobaan yang anda lakukan dan buat laporan.
note
• Kirim laporan sementara ke hendri@eepis-its.edu dengan format
◦ subjek: [prak2lj-jarkom-temp]
◦ isi: nama,nrp dari tiap kelompok
◦ attachment: laporan sementara
• Kirim laporan final ke hendri@eepis-its.edu dengan format
◦ subjek: [prak2lj-jarkom-final]
◦ isi: nama,nrp dari tiap kelompok
attachment: laporan final
• Laporan final dikirim paling lambat hari selasa minggu depan jam 5 sore. Tidak ada
perpanjangan deadline walaupun hari libur. Laporan yang dikirim setelah waktu deadline
tidak akan saya terima.